About XpertDox
XpertDox, Inc. is a physician-founded, venture-backed healthcare AI company headquartered in Scottsdale, Arizona, with a global delivery team in India. Our platform, XpertCoding, autonomously codes outpatient medical claims directly from clinical documentation using neural networks, machine learning, and natural language processing.
Position Summary
You own XpertDox's web platforms end to end: the client-facing analytics and reporting product that healthcare executives, practice managers, and billers use every day, and the internal applications the company runs its operations on. Ownership covers both the engineering and the product requirements for these platforms, so you decide what gets built and how well it gets built. The engineering team that builds with you is part of our global delivery team in Noida, India, which means leading through clear written specifications, disciplined asynchronous review, and standards that hold when you are not in the room. The role splits roughly evenly between writing production code and leading that team. It is not a fit for someone who wants to stop coding, and it is not a fit for someone who wants to only code. Because these applications support clinical and financial decisions in an environment governed by HIPAA, SOC 2 Type 2, and ISO 27001, quality and reliability are how the product is judged, and you are accountable for raising the bar on everything that ships.
